SINGAPORE (The Straits Times/ANN): The Republic is in a critical period of its fight against Covid-19, and new cases will continue to be picked up before tapering off in about two weeks, said Finance Minister Lawrence Wong on Tuesday (May 18).
He added that the infections picked up now were likely seeded two weeks ago, and he was confident the latest round of measures would bring down the numbers.
